Some additional things to not do...

  • Don't include 20 different user tracking scripts.
  • Don't ignore performance.
  • Don't use the default web server configurations.
  • Don't use video backgrounds.
  • Don't load the page and then make a dozen ajax calls for content.
  • Don't use assets from third parties.
  • Don't rely on cookies.
  • Don't try to figure out my location.
  • Don't try to track every mouse click, scroll or movement.
  • Don't have long timeouts.
  • Don't cheap on hosting.
  • Don't forget to test usability under load.
  • Don't forget to test usability across multiple browsers/os.
  • Don't forget to enable TLS.
